首页 理论教育KeilC51集成环境下的软件调试与编写

KeilC51集成环境下的软件调试与编写

【摘要】:本设计中源程序的编写与调试是在Keil C51集成环境中进行的。保存为hejia-jian.c的名字,,单击保存按钮。单击Target 1前面的+号,展开里面的内容Source Group1,用右键单击Sourece Group 1,将弹出一个菜单,选择Add Files to Guoup'Source Group 1',文件类型选择C Source file(*.c)。单击add按钮之后,窗口不会消失,,添加完毕此时再单击Close关闭该窗口,这时在Source Group 1里就有hejiajian.c文件。程序在Keil软件下编译成功,如图16-11所示。图16-11 程序调试图图16-12 程序下载图

本设计中源程序的编写与调试是在Keil C51集成环境中进行的。首先建立一个新的工程,单击菜单project,选择new project,然后选择要保存的路径,输入工程文件的名字,如保存到keil目录里,工程文件的名字为hejiajian,然后单击保存按钮。这时会弹出一个对话框,要求你选择单片机的型号,你可以根据使用的单片机来选择,keil C51几乎支持所有的51类型的单片机,如果设计的是AT89S52,可以选择Amtel->AT89S52,选择89S52之后,右边一栏是对这个单片机基本的说明,然后单击确定按钮。这时要新建一个源程序文件,建立一个汇编或c文件,如果你已经有源程序文件,可以忽略这一步。单击菜单File->New命令,输入一个简单的程序,选择菜单File→SAVE命令,选择你要保存的路径,在文件名里输入文件名,注意一定要输入扩展名,由于是c程序文件,扩展名为.c。保存为hejia-jian.c的名字,(也可以保存为其他名字,如learn.c等),单击保存按钮。单击Target 1前面的+号,展开里面的内容Source Group1,用右键单击Sourece Group 1(注意用鼠标的右键,而不是左键),将弹出一个菜单,选择Add Files to Guoup'Source Group 1',文件类型选择C Source file(*.c)。选择刚才的文件test.c,最后单击Add按钮。单击add按钮之后,窗口不会消失,(如果要添加多个文件,可以不断添加),添加完毕此时再单击Close关闭该窗口,这时在Source Group 1里就有hejiajian.c文件。

程序在Keil软件下编译成功,如图16-11所示。

在Keil软件下编译成功后,生成.hex文件,再用ISP和单片机程序烧写器将图16-11编译成功的程序下载到单片机AT89S52中,其下载成功的界面如图16-12所示。

978-7-111-47690-0-Part03-21.jpg(www.chuimin.cn)

图16-11 程序调试图

978-7-111-47690-0-Part03-22.jpg

图16-12 程序下载图